From Sap to Sweetness: The Journey of Organic Coconut Sugar

 

The story of organic coconut sugar is not just about a simple ingredient; it’s a compelling narrative of sustainable agriculture, ethical practices, and a deep connection to nature. Unlike the industrial-scale farming of other sweeteners, the production of organic coconut sugar is a craft that begins high up in the canopy of the coconut palm tree. It is a process that has been passed down through generations, and it speaks directly to the modern consumer's growing demand for transparency and a clear, clean-label product. The journey of this sweetener from the heart of the palm to the kitchen shelf is a prime example of how the Organic Coconut Sugar Market is built on a foundation of responsible and mindful production.

The essence of organic coconut sugar's appeal lies in its minimal environmental footprint. Coconut palms are perennial trees that do not require annual replanting, a significant advantage over other sugar crops like sugarcane, which are highly resource-intensive. These trees are remarkably resilient, thriving in diverse ecosystems with minimal need for water, fertilizer, or pesticides. This low-input farming model is a cornerstone of sustainable sourcing. By requiring fewer resources and avoiding synthetic chemicals, coconut sugar production helps to preserve soil health, protect local water supplies, and support the biodiversity of the regions where it is cultivated. It’s a process that works in harmony with the environment, rather than against it.

The production itself is a delicate and labor-intensive process. Skilled harvesters, known as "tappers," carefully climb the tall coconut palms to collect the sweet nectar from the flower blossoms. A small incision is made in the blossoms, and the flowing sap is collected in containers, a process that does not harm the tree and allows it to continue producing for decades. The collected sap is then gently heated in large woks to evaporate its water content. This simple, traditional method ensures that the sugar retains its naturally rich, caramel-like flavor and its signature nutrient profile, including trace amounts of iron, zinc, and potassium. The lack of heavy machinery or chemical bleaching agents in this process is a key factor that appeals to consumers seeking pure and unprocessed ingredients.

The versatility of the coconut palm further reinforces its reputation as a champion of sustainable practices. The very same trees that yield the sap for sugar also produce coconuts for milk, oil, and water, as well as husks and shells that can be used for fuel and other by-products. This multi-purpose use of a single crop reduces waste and maximizes efficiency, making the coconut palm one of the most productive and eco-friendly plants in the world.
